Branding on the Collar

Collar Branding Styles

The collar is one of the most underutilized yet high-potential branding areas on a POLO shirt.

Ideal For:

  • Slogans or taglines
  • Subtle company names or initials
  • Decorative stripe or woven patterns

Techniques:

  • Embroidery (on top or underside of collar)
  • Jacquard knitting (for woven collar tape)

Tips:

  • Use contrasting or brand colors to create a pop.
  • Keep text small and minimal for a clean look.

Real-World Use:

A tech startup might embroider their URL or a hashtag inside the back collar as a unique conversation starter.

Branding on the Chest

The left chest is the most classic and popular branding location for a reason — it’s front and center, perfect for a logo or icon.

Ideal For:

  • Brand logos
  • Emblems or initials

Techniques:

  • Embroidery (for durability and premium feel)
  • Heat transfer or screen print (for larger, colorful logos)

Tips:

  • Keep logo size proportional: 2.5″ to 4″ wide is typical.
  • Use embroidery for sharp, textured finishes.

Real-World Use:

Hospitality brands and corporate teams often choose embroidery here to add a premium touch that lasts through frequent washes.

Branding on the Sleeve

Sleeves offer an extended canvas often overlooked. Branding here can be subtle yet effective.

Ideal For:

  • Short slogans or URLs
  • Campaign-specific graphics
  • Secondary logos or icons

Techniques:

  • Embroidery (near the hem)
  • Screen printing (larger wrap designs)

Tips:

  • Choose short messages or vertical logos to suit the narrow space.
  • Match sleeve branding with the primary chest logo for cohesion.

Real-World Use:

Event staff or sports teams often place event names or team slogans on the right sleeve to complement the main chest logo.

Branding Inside or Outside the Label

Label Customization Examples

Labels are often missed as a branding opportunity. Adding your branding to the neck or side label helps solidify your identity in subtle but powerful ways.

Ideal For:

  • Brand name and logo
  • Sizing, care instructions + tagline
  • QR code linking to your site or socials

Techniques:

  • Woven label (for external side seam or hem branding)
  • Printed label (for inner neck branding)
  • Heat transfer label (soft, tagless feel)

Tips:

  • Ensure compliance with regional labeling laws.
  • Use this space for brand storytelling: “Designed for Champions”, “Built to Perform” etc.

Real-World Use:

DTC fashion brands often use printed neck labels with QR codes to promote their Instagram or brand mission.

Coordinating Your Branding Elements for Impact

To make your branding consistent and professional, think about how different elements interact. For example:

  • Pair a bold chest logo with a minimal collar detail.
  • Use brand color consistency across chest, sleeve, and collar.
  • Keep typography and design style uniform.

Recommended Combinations:

  • Classic Corporate: Embroidered left chest logo + printed neck label
  • Bold Promotion: Screen-printed large chest + sleeve hashtag + collar slogan
  • Premium Fashion: Jacquard collar + subtle chest embroidery + side hem woven tag
